Here, we aimed to evaluate changes in the tumor immune microenvironment after E.G7-OVA tumor-bearing mice received adoptive transfer of naïve OT-I CD8+ T cells, followed by a DNA vaccine, and 90Y-NM600. Tumors were collected 7 and 14 days following 90Y-NM600, isolated total RNA, and performed gene expression analysis using the nCounter Mouse Immune Exhaustion Panel on the nCounter MAX system.","dates":{"publication":"2026/06/19"},"accession":"GSE330657","cross_references":{"GSM":["GSM9729951","GSM9729940","GSM9729950","GSM9729942","GSM9729941","GSM9729944","GSM9729943","GSM9729946","GSM9729945","GSM9729948","GSM9729937","GSM9729947","GSM9729939","GSM9729938","GSM9729949"],"GPL":["32403"],"GSE":["330657"],"taxon":["Mus musculus"]}}
